Major Responsibilities and Duties:

 

PBIS / Behavior Support

  1. Support implementation of campus PBIS expectations, routines, and reinforcement systems (e.g., acknowledgements, incentives, tracking).
  2. Provide positive redirection and reinforcement of expected behaviors in classrooms, hallways, cafeteria, bus areas, and other campus settings.
  3. Assist with small-group or individual behavior skill-building as directed; help students practice appropriate replacement behaviors.
  4. Support students during escalation by using approved de-escalation strategies and calling for administrative support as needed, following campus procedures.
  5. Supervise and support students assigned to behavior interventions (e.g., restorative reflection, re-teach of expectations, structured check-ins).
  6. Implement components of student behavior plans (e.g., check-in/check-out, behavior contracts, point sheets) under the direction of campus administration and/or certified staff.
